Minimizing overgrown plants is a vital aspect of landscape management, helping to restore order, enhance aesthetic appeals,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can restrict airflow, lower sunlight penetration, and produce chances for bugs and illness. Pruning and thinning are the primary methods for handling thick or rowdy plant life, enabling plants to thrive while keeping a controlled appearance. The procedure involves selectively eliminating excess branches, stems, and foliage, constantly thinking about the natural growth practice of each species. Timing is important; some plants react best to pruning throughout dormancy, while blooming varieties may need post-bloom trimming to maintain blooms. Appropriate technique ensures cuts are clean and positioned to motivate healthy brand-new growth. In addition to enhancing plant health, reducing overgrowth improves accessibility and exposure in the landscape Paths, driveways, and outside living spaces end up being much safer and more inviting. Long-term maintenance strategies avoid future overgrowth, making sure a balanced and harmonious landscape.
